Hydroxyapatite
What Is Hydroxyapatite?
Hydroxyapatite is a naturally occurring calcium phosphate mineral.
It is the primary mineral component found in:
- Tooth enamel
- Dentin
- Human bones
Because of its close similarity to natural enamel, hydroxyapatite has become increasingly popular in modern dental care products.

Dextranase
What Is Dextranase?
Dextranase is a specialized enzyme that breaks down dextran—a sticky substance produced by certain oral bacteria.
Dextran helps bacteria attach firmly to teeth and contributes to plaque biofilm formation.

The Science Behind the Oral Microbiome
The oral microbiome has become one of the most discussed topics in modern dental research.
Scientists estimate that the human mouth contains more than 700 species of microorganisms.
These organisms interact continuously with:
- Saliva
- Teeth
- Gums
- Tongue
- Oral tissues
A balanced microbiome supports normal oral function, while an imbalance may contribute to plaque accumulation and gum irritation.
Current research suggests that maintaining microbial diversity may be an important part of long-term oral health.
